Product Information

Extended Description

STS366ND3 Eaton: Eaton Shunt trip safety switch, 600 A, Coil V: 120 Vac, NEMA 12/3R, 600 V, Three-pole, Fusible with neutral
Product Name
Eaton shunt trip safety switch
Catalog Number
STS366ND3
UPC
786685828954
Product Length/Depth
12.43 in
Product Height
62.97 in
Product Width
28.29 in
Product Weight
149 lb
Warranty
Eaton Selling Policy 25-000, one (1) year from the date of installation of the Product or eighteen (18) months from the date of shipment of the Product, whichever occurs first.
Certifications
UL Listed cUL Certified
Enclosure
NEMA 12, NEMA 3R
Number Of Poles
Three-pole
Type
Shunt trip safety switch
Amperage Rating
600A
Coil voltage
120 Vac
Protection
Fusible
Voltage rating
600 Vac, 250 Vdc
